- The distance between Tallahassee, Fl, Usa and Parana, Brazil is approximately 6,170 km or 3,834 mi.
- To reach Tallahassee, Fl in this distance one would set out from Parana bearing 321.5°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Tallahassee, Fl bearing 315.2° or NW .
- Tallahassee, Fl has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Parana has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
- Both are in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
- The average temperature is 5.5 °C (9.9°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 13.8 °C (24.8°F) more in Tallahassee, Fl.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 339.5 mm (13.4 in) more which is equivalent to 339.5 l/m² (8.33 US gal/ft²) or 3,395,000 l/ha (362,948 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/4 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 12.5° lower in Tallahassee, Fl than in Parana.
